select the correct answer.
a school bus has 25 seats, with 5 rows of 5 seats. 15 students from the first grade and 5 students from the second grade travel in the bus. how many ways can the students be seated if all the first-grade students occupy the first 3 rows?
\\(_{25}p_{20}\\)
\\(_{5}p_{5} \times {}_{20}p_{15}\\)
\\(_{15}c_{15} \times {}_{10}c_{5}\\)
\\(_{15}p_{15} \times {}_{10}p_{5}\\)
\\(_{15}p_{15} \times {}_{10}c_{5}\\)
Seat the first-grade students in the first 3 rows
$$
{}_{15}\text{P}_{15}
$$
Seat the second-grade students in the remaining seats
$$
{}_{10}\text{P}_{5}
$$
Combine the independent seating arrangements
$$
{}_{15}\text{P}_{15} \times {}_{10}\text{P}_{5}
$$
